A Diploma in Aeronautical Engineering is typically a three-year technical program designed to equip students with knowledge and skills related to the design, development, maintenance, and testing of aircraft and their systems. The curriculum integrates theoretical studies with hands-on practical training, ensuring students are well-prepared to take on real-world challenges in the aerospace sector.
The course is divided into six semesters, each focusing on core aeronautical subjects like aerodynamics, aircraft structures, propulsion, avionics, and aircraft maintenance. The final semester often includes industrial training and a project, giving students industry exposure and applied learning experience.
To pursue a Diploma in Aeronautical Engineering from a reputed college in Delhi, candidates must meet the following eligibility criteria:
1. Educational Qualification
Minimum Requirement: Pass in 10th standard (SSC) from a recognized board (CBSE or State Board).
Subjects: Must have studied Mathematics and Science as compulsory subjects.
Minimum Marks: Typically, a minimum of 45% to 50% aggregate marks is required (varies slightly by institution).
2. Age Limit
The general age requirement is 15 to 21 years at the time of admission.
Age relaxation may apply as per government norms for reserved categories (SC/ST/OBC).
3. Entrance Exam (if applicable)
Some government or private colleges may conduct entrance exams for admission.
Others may admit students based on merit in the 10th board examination.
4. Medical Fitness
Candidates should be physically and medically fit, especially due to the technical nature of aeronautical engineering.
Some colleges may require a medical fitness certificate during admission.
5. Nationality
The applicant must be an Indian citizen.

The course structure is designed to cover both foundational engineering principles and specialized aeronautical knowledge. Key subjects include:
Engineering Mathematics and Physics
Aircraft Structures
Aerodynamics
Aircraft Propulsion Systems
Flight Mechanics
Aircraft Maintenance Practices
Aircraft Instruments and Avionics
Computer-Aided Design (CAD)
Hydraulics and Pneumatics
Aviation Safety and Quality Control
Additionally, students undertake practical lab sessions, workshops, and projects to reinforce their theoretical knowledge.

The average salary for fresh diploma holders in aeronautical engineering typically ranges from 5.5 to 8.5 LPA. With 3–5 years of experience, professionals can earn between 10–15 LPA, especially if they work in R&D or international projects.
Factors influencing salary:
Type of organization (government vs. private)
Technical skill set and certifications
Location and job profile
Internship and project performance during the diploma
